George Furth

AKA: George Schweinfurth
Birthday: 1932-12-14
Died: 2008-08-11
Birthplace: Chicago, Illinois, USA


George Furth (born George Schweinfurth; December 14, 1932 – August 11, 2008) was an American librettist, playwright, and actor.
